    Diary of a Wimpy Kid: The Last Straw is a novel written by American author and cartoonist Jeff Kinney‚ the third book in the Diary of a Wimpy Kid series. The book acts as a journal and follows the adventures of Greg Heffley‚ the narrator of the book‚ who is in the second half of his seventh grade year.[1] Despite the title‚ it is not the final book in the series; the title comes from the threat of military school to toughen Greg up.
